That's pretty weird advice, to be honest. A new FM version is just an update, and overall these game get better over time. They're not 100% polished at release, sure, but they never end up being that because there are only so many patches a game with a 1 year release cycle can get. For instance, FM18 changed the match engine and never fixed a bunch of glaring issues with it (throw-ins going to the opposition, direct free kicks being worthless, sliding tackles turning into assists for an opposition striker all the time etc). FM19's match engine isn't all the way there yet, and it will also never be, but it's a massive step up from FM18. The games do get gradually more complex, but if you want to be able to finish a season in a day neither FM18 or 19 are going to give you that. Mainly when a new FM comes out the question for me is whether to get it at all, not when. Especially since these games are always on sale somewhere; you can get good deals from day one on, moreso than for other new releases. I got FM19 for 30 bucks a week or so after release. Also, speaking just for myself, the most important argument for FM19 to me was that the face generation is just kinda bad now instead of completely atrocious. People don't look like slugs wearing wigs anymore and they don't change their skin color.
